Just what is the base TL for robots and how does staging affect them? At the very least I would expect the same design robot to be smaller and/or lighter as TL improved...

Unfortunately it doesn't say, and there is no mention of staging in the robot section. However using a few rough 'rules of thumb' from canon...

It's mentioned in the books the first 'True' autonomous robots were used by the Soli's during/after the war with the Vilani - they were nominally TL 12 at the time. The positronic brain and F+ robot power also become available at TL 12.

So using TL 12 as the baseline (standard). You can have 'ultimate' model robots at TL 16 an Experimental robots at TL 9 (roughly where we are now) which covers most of the 'Golden Age' traveller setting.

Now you can use vehicle maker/thing maker to adjust for staging - the big one being -4 Bulk, which you could translate into being smaller (or the same size but stronger/faster due to more actuators being put in). Another is Reliability - add more time till you roll for the robot going decon or onwee.
 
Don't forget that robots appear at around TL7 in terms of control systems and mechanical capability. The two don't necessarily have to go hand-in-hand, so you could have some fairly autonomous systems by TL9. Expert systems would be built at the TL8-9 interface, which would allow for seeming independence.
 
Just started considering this so I'm re-animating this thread for T5.10.

The TL Stage Effects Table (one of a bazillion throughout the rules) in Bk 2, pg. 226 is different from most in that it includes a ThingMaker Mass adjustment column, which I think might be appropriate for Robots. So, Stage can adjust the Cost and Units required for components. (Units being volume, and indirectly, Mass)

Interestingly, this ThingMaker Mass adjustment due to Stage does NOT appear anywhere in the ThingMaker rules. In ThingMaker, this is left to the designer as hand-wavium.

Base technologies for robot components can be gleaned from Bk 2, pages 231, 250, and 263. Photonic and Fluidic Brain TL are taken from the model 1 computers of those types on pg. 250.

TL
9 Electronic Brain
11 Semi-Organic Clone Brain, Fusion Plus
12 Photonic Brain, Positronic Brain, Personality Recording And Editing
13 Fluidic Brain, Robots, Robot Solid State Structural Muscle. Cloning. Forced Growth. Wafer Technology
14 Self-Aware, Geneering
15
16 Artificial Intelligence

So the base TL for Robots is TL 13 with components not mentioned adjusted via Stage from that base. Components explicitly mentioned would be adjusted via Stage from their own base using the Cost and Mass adjustments from pg. 226.
